Malcolm X Drummers and Dancers Review
by Afrika Midnight Asha Abney

The Malcolm X Drummers and Dancers are one of my favorite Traditional West African Drumming and Dancing companies based in the Metropolitan region. I have had the opportunity to perfprm and  participate in many of their events and this is a very interactive group that gives both the drummers and dancers an opportunity to interact with the audience.

The Malcolm X Drummers and Dancers are a group of tremendously talented artists that grew out of the cultural experience demonstrated at Malcolm X Park and is founded by Doc Powell.
 
Drummers from all walks of life, and from every level of drumming abilities, other musicians of all varieties, and spectators of all nationalities and ages, come together and create a wonderful expression of creative energies.
 
From this setting, arose a group of performing artists called the Malcolm X Drummers and Dancers.
 
Some of its company members are Donald Donga, King Baba James, Becky Umeh, Roberto Dominich, Dion Jacobs, Jaamin Tempo, Doc Powell, and Kombo Omolara.
 
The Malcolm X Drummers and Dancers have performed at a variety of venues.
